Sterling Heights, MI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 48314?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 48314 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,337 | $785 | $2,030 |
| 48314 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,767 | $950 | $2,940 |
| 48314 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,148 | $1,950 | $2,545 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 48314 ZIP Code
What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in the 48314 ZIP Code?
As of today, September 04, 2026, there are currently 42 available 48314 apartments priced from $785 to $2,940, with an average monthly rent of $1,577.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 48314 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 48314 ranges from $785 to $2,030 with an average monthly rent of $1,337.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 48314 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 48314 range from $950 to $2,940.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,767.
